Last year I picked up some Church TX 22 boards to try out. I've only used them twice so far. Both times pulling a deep diving Reef Runner or Rapala Tail Dancer. And both times the board nosed dived and sank. Took me forever to get the dam thing back in.

What am I doing wrong? Do I have the weight too far forward?

When the board dives point the rod tip downward towards the board and reel quickly . I've found that reeling them in fast right from the start usually prevents the diving.

Weights should be back to adjust depending on what you are pulling. Reef runnings don't put a lot of drag on the boards.  Definitely not enough to have both weights forward.

 

Is it diving when you are just leaving it out there, or when you are reeling it back in?

 

If it's when you are reeling it back in, there's a trick, as Sk8man points out.  Put the rod time close to the water when it's about 30 ft away and reel fast towards the center of the boat.

 

If it does nose dive, the only way to get it back is to let line out fast (to take the drag off) without bird nesting your reel.
